Characterization of $n$-dimensional normal affine $SL_n$ -varieties

Abstract

We show that any normal irreducible affine nn-dimensional SLnSL_n-variety XX is determined by its automorphism group in the category of normal irreducible affine varieties: if YY is an irreducible affine normal algebraic variety such that Aut(X)Aut(Y)Aut(X) \cong Aut(Y) as ind-groups, then YXY \cong X as varieties. If we drop the condition of normality on YY , then XX is not uniquely determined and we classify all such varieties. In case n3n \ge 3, all the above results hold true if we replace Aut(X)Aut(X) by U(X)U(X), where U(X)U(X) is the subgroup of Aut(X)Aut(X) generated by all one-dimensional unipotent subgroups. In dimension 22 we have some very interesting exceptions.
